2023/2024 Transfer Portal Recap – Oklahoma State

By Mark Pszonak

With action in the transfer portal slowing down, it is time to take a closer look at how each P4 school did during this cycle. Up now are the Oklahoma State Cowboys

The skinny: Coming off a 10-4 season, Oklahoma State was able to retain most of their important players on both sides of the ball as they positioned themselves for a potentially memorable season in Stillwater. On top of that, the Cowboys also only had nine scholarship players enter the portal during this cycle, one of the lesser amounts in the country. While head coach Mike Gundy didn’t have to dive into the portal too deeply during this cycle, he was still able to add a few important pieces that could prove to be invaluable as the season progresses.

Total # entries into portal: 18

Total # of scholarship players who entered portal: 9

Number of scholarship players who withdrew: 0

Key losses: WR Jaden Bray (West Virginia), DB D.J. McKinney (Colorado)

Key additions: WR Gavin Freeman (Oklahoma), TE Tyler Foster (Ohio), DE Obi Ezeigbo (D2 Gannon), DB Kobe Hylton (UTEP)

Final thoughts: With elite returning talent like RB Ollie Gordon II, the nation’s leading returning rusher, LB Collin Oliver, S Kendal Daniels, WR Brennan Presley and LB Nick Martin all returning, plus QB Alan Bowman back for his seventh collegiate season, the Cowboys didn’t have to be very aggressive in the portal. One concern is the defensive line, which they hope to have addressed by adding pass rusher Obi Ezeigbo. He dominated the Division II level last year, but how will that translate to the Big 12? The passing game already had the potential to be explosive, but then the Cowboys added WR Gavin Freeman and TE Tyler Foster, while the secondary added depth and experience with Kobe Hylton, who totaled 146 tackles, 10.5 tackles for a loss and seven pass breakups during his last two seasons at UTEP. Some programs use the portal to try and reload their roster, Oklahoma State was in a position this year to just try and enhance a few positions. Everyone will see if that was enough to take the Cowboys to the next level in 2024.
